How To Test The Speed Of A Brushed DC Motor?
Leave a message
The speed of a DC brushed motor can be tested by using some tools and equipment. The following are some methods to test the speed of DC brushed motors:
1. Using a multimeter: You can use the speed measurement function of a multimeter to test the speed of a motor. Ground the black test pin of the multimeter, connect the red test pin to one lead of the motor, then turn the motor and observe the reading of the multimeter to get the speed of the motor.

2. Use Hall sensor: Hall sensor can measure the position and speed of the motor rotor. Install the Hall sensor on the rotor of the motor, then connect the output signal of the sensor to a digital measuring instrument to measure the rotational speed of the motor.
3. Using a tachometer: A tachometer is a device specifically designed to measure the rotational speed of a rotating object and can be used to test the rotational speed of a DC brush motor. The speed of the motor can be measured by contacting the sensor of the tachometer with the rotating object on the motor shaft and then starting the motor.

4. Use photoelectric measuring instrument: Photoelectric measuring instrument is a device used to measure the speed of object movement, which can be used to test the speed of DC brush motor. The speed of the motor can be measured by aligning the sensor of the photoelectric meter with the object on which the motor is rotating and then starting the motor.

These are some common ways to test the speed of DC brushed motors. It is important to note that when performing the speed test, you need to comply with the relevant safety regulations to ensure that the testing process is safe and reliable.
